JOB DESCRIPTION
The Automation Engineer is responsible for the design, development, integration, and support of automated hydraulic, electric, and pneumatic systems used in drilling and pressure-control applications. This role combines application engineering, controls design, programming, and field support to develop practical automation solutions for valve actuation, rig integration, and related control-system projects. The position works closely with the Drilling Automation & Controls Manager and cross-functional teams across mechanical, electrical, software, production, quality, and field operations to move solutions from concept through implementation, commissioning, and sustainment. The role supports both new product development and customer-facing applications by producing technically sound, documented, and field-ready systems that meet performance, safety, and operational requirements.
RESPONSIBILITIES
*Not an all-inclusive list
- Design, develop, and apply automated hydraulic, pneumatic, and electric systems for drilling, rig integration, valve actuation, and pressure-control applications.
- Develop control system architecture, PLC software, HMI screens, control logic, and industrial communication interfaces for new and existing systems.
- Translate functional requirements into system-level solutions, including control philosophies, I/O architecture, instrumentation strategy, and hardware / software integration plans.
- Support development and troubleshooting of control algorithms, interlocks, alarm logic, PID-based functions, and automation features that improve safety, repeatability, and operating efficiency.
- Produce accurate system, loop, block, wiring, and network diagrams, along with design documentation, operating manuals, commissioning records, and other technical documentation for code and hardware.
- Coordinate with mechanical, electrical, software, and production personnel to ensure cohesive system development, assembly, testing, and deployment.
- Generate work tasks, support ordering and delivery of equipment and materials, and assist with installation, commissioning, and startup of control systems and automated equipment.
- Provide on-site and remote technical support to field personnel and operations teams for troubleshooting PLC, HMI, instrumentation, communication, and actuation issues.
- Follow formal revision control and change-management processes for software and control-system updates to ensure changes are introduced in a controlled and documented manner.
- Support project execution by assisting with scope definition, schedule coordination, technical risk identification, and status updates for assigned automation and application engineering tasks.
- Prepare technical input for quotations, proposals, and customer application reviews, including concept definition, equipment selection, and execution assumptions.
- Work directly with third-party contractors, operations, technical services, HSE, and field crews to support project execution, commissioning, and issue resolution.
- Support and participate in the organization’s Continual Improvement Program and comply with applicable QMS, HSE, and company procedures and policies.

REQUIRED EXPERIENCE & SKILLS
- 5+ years of application engineering, controls engineering, automation engineering, or closely related experience in industrial or oilfield equipment environments
- Hands-on experience with hydraulic, pneumatic, and electric system design and integration
- Experience with PLC programming, HMI development, control-system architecture, and implementation of industrial communication protocols
- Ability to apply control-system theory to new and existing equipment, including interlocks, sequencing, alarm management, and feedback-control functions
- Ability to understand and translate functional requirements into practical hardware and software system designs
- Experience generating technical documentation such as drawings, loop diagrams, network diagrams, operation manuals, and commissioning records
-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ills with the ability to support both remote and field-based issue resolution
- Ability to manage multiple tasks and projects simultaneously and adapt to shifting business priorities
- Clear written and verbal communication skills with the ability to work effectively across engineering, operations, service, and customer-facing teams
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and standard engineering / project documentation tools
PREFERRED EXPERIENCE & SKILLS
- Experience designing and troubleshooting drilling controls, rig integration systems, or oilfield automation packages
- Experience developing PLC code in ladder logic, structured text, statement list, SFC, or similar programming environments
- Experience with LabVIEW, NI CompactRIO, FPGA, or real-time industrial control platforms
- Familiarity with industrial protocols and data acquisition systems such as TCP/IP, OPC/UA, Modbus, Ethernet, cRIO, or similar platforms
- Experience with servo drives, motor control, instrumentation, sensor integration, and electric design of PLC-based systems
- Experience with 6A valve, plug valve, or related actuation systems and working knowledge of drilling-industry equipment
- Experience with SolidWorks or similar mechanical design software
- Experience working in oil and gas, drilling automation, or managed pressure drilling applications
